2014-06-09 - This entry describes an original installation of a new pipe organ. Identified by T. Daniel Hancock, based on personal knowledge of the organ. -- Opus 163 is one of two instruments installed by Schoenstein in 2013, a two-manual, 14-rank sanctuary organ which is complemented by Opus 164, a three-manual, 35-rank gallery instrument; the former is operable from the three manual console in the gallery for Opus 164, but also has its own dedicated two-manual console in the sanctuary, which can also play the gallery organ. -Database Manager

      Sanctuary Organ, Opus 163
      OHS ID: 52775
      
      GREAT            pipes     CHOIR                        PEDAL (enclosed)    
    8 Open Diapason.......61   8 Salicional [2].....49   16 Double Bass [4].....12
    8 Harmonic Flute......61   8 Stopped Diapason...61   16 Bourdon...........(Gt)
    4 Principal...........61   8 Echo Gamba.........61    8 Harmonic Flute....(Gt)
   16 Bourdon (Ch)........12   8 Vox Angelica.......61    8 Stopped Diapason..(Ch)
    8 Stopped Diapason..(Ch)   4 Salicet............12    4 Harmonic Flute....(Gt)
    2 Mixture II-V......(Ch)   4 Flute..............12    8 Trumpet...........(Ch)
   16 Double Trumpet TC.(Ch)   2 Salicetina.........12    4 Rohrschalmei......(Gt)
    8 Trumpet...........(Ch)   2 Mixture II-V......206
    8 Rohrschalmei [1]....37   8 Trumpet............61
      Tremulant.........(Ch)   8 Tuba Major [3]

      NOTES
   1. This stop to tenor c only, and enclosed in Choir expression box.
   2. Twelve bass pipes common with Stopped Diapason 8.
   3. From Gallery Organ, see specification below.
   4. Extended from Great Harmonic Flute 8.
   5. Full array of couplers and mechanicals on both consoles.
